At a secret mining facility somewhere in the deserts of Rajasthan, an ancient place of worship, with disturbing carvings on its dome, is discovered buried deep inside the earth. Soon the miners find themselves in the grip of terrifying waking nightmares. One tries to mutilate himself. Worse follows.

Five experts are called in to investigate these strange occurrences. Sucked into a nightmare deep underground, they embark on a perilous journey; a journey that will change them forever, bringing them face-to-face with the most shattering truth of them all…

The greatest evil lies deep inside.

Disturbing. Outstanding!
By Suhel Banerjee
Disclaimer: I know the author personally.

If I were a Bollywood hero, at this time I should've been in India, trying to trace the author in one of his many book launch events, with the sole purpose of avenging the trauma his book caused my wife. But hero, I'm not. So, I'm at my laptop at quarter past two in the morning, writing this review, while my wife is sleeping next to me, perhaps being haunted by images from the same book in her nightmares. Shameful.

Actually the only word that truly describes the book is repulsive. Perhaps revolting also fits the bill. Yes, the famous humour blogger and author of MIHYAP has come up with the kind of stuff that leaves a terrible stench in the mouth. And from what I understand, that, precisely is what he set out to do in this makeover second book.

'The Mine' is a horror story, but not along the lines of 'Zee Horror Show' or 'Andheri Raat Mein Diya Tere Haath Mein', which of course you'll perhaps associate more with the author. However, in this book Arnab almost makes it a point to not have a single line that can make you smile, leave alone laugh. Through the story of an assorted cast of characters with a past, brought together at 'The Mine', where funny things are going on, we are brought face to face with a different kind of horror, that lies deep within ourselves. The kind that we can't even dare to accept while introspecting. In case I give an impression that it's a philosophical novel which asks you to look into your heart and listen to your parents (I love K3G) I am doing it completely wrong. Think of any sort of macabre grossness and you will find it in the pages of 'The Mine'. Some parts of the book are so explicit in its gory details that I felt uncomfortable to talk to him after reading the book knowing what his fertile imagination is capable of cooking up! If you're thinking of sweeping that girl you've been fancying for sometime by gifting a copy of this on the day of Saint Valentine's feast, consider yourself warned.

I personally have always felt that Arnab is a far superior writer while tackling serious issues and topics and his thorough research for so many of his blog posts have helped me and others to understand many complicated world issues in a very personalized and descriptive fashion. 'The Mine' is the epitome of his serious, focused, researched and nuanced writing.

I don't want to give away any part of the story, even inadvertently, because I feel the very essence of the book is in facing the unexpected and is best enjoyed by going in with no preconceived notion, besides being ready to bear some very hard hitting ideas.

It takes immense courage to present oneself, so early in one's career, in a completely different shade from what the audience expects and then to shock them with the kind of negativity and gore as is there in the book.

So much more than a thriller.
By Amazon Customer
So I finally got to read "The Mine". It has been a long wait since the preview of the book and a painful one, thanks to the early release in India. These past few months, I watched from the sidelines as all the chosen ones read it, savored it (mostly) and reviewed it in `mind-blowing' and `unputdownable' terms. Not known to have an appetite for horror, I was initially a bit hesitant, read scared, to enter the Mine. So I started reading it on a crowded public bus on a bright sunny afternoon, hoping that the presence of other humans will keep all ghosts at bay. But who knew that halfway through the book, I would start looking at humanity in a new light and almost crave the company of ghosts?

The book is of course an excellent read. Ray's style is fast-paced and meticulous at the same time: no small detail is left unattended yet not a word feels superfluous. Being able to capture the import and the essence of a wide spectrum of situations- from communal riots to Kolkata winter afternoons, from the devil's lair to domestic bliss, with such precision using just the right amount of words, is no mean feat. Same with his characters- in few masterstrokes he presents to us people so real that we can almost anticipate the moments when one of them would roll their eyes or would purse their lips when reacting to a certain situation.

The real fun, though, begins after the book is over. That is when you start asking yourself all kinds of questions, the answers to which you don't want to know. You become aware how you, like the characters in the novel, are just a nobody suspended in an emulsion of life watching helplessly as virtues and vices mix into each other and then separate out in moments, only to become inseparable once again. As Ray's characters make their way through the mine, they seem to battle blood and gore, traps and trials, but what are they really battling? Their mine seems to be no different from my mine, from all of our mines, where we forge ahead everyday, battling mistrust and hate with solidarity and empathy. And we make wrong turns. Even on perfectly well-lit paths.

No one expects a thriller to initiate a deep, philosophical evaluation (or at least a consideration) of one's worldview, but in the greatest twist of all, "The Mine" does exactly that.
